The global hydrogen market is experiencing substantial growth, valued at US$141.59 billion in 2022 and expected to grow at a CAGR of 7% until 2030. This growth is primarily attributed to the increasing demand from the petrochemical industry and the adoption of hydrogen as a clean energy source in various sectors. Industries such as automotive, chemical, and electronics are transitioning to hydrogen due to its zero-emission nature. Government initiatives worldwide are promoting the use of clean fuels like hydrogen for transportation and power generation. Fuel cells powered by hydrogen are gaining momentum, especially in electric vehicles and electricity generation. Major automakers like Toyota and Hyundai are investing in fuel cell electric vehicles, further driving the market growth. Additionally, the development of renewable hydrogen hubs presents a lucrative opportunity to synthesize hydrogen from clean resources and cater to multiple sectors efficiently. This approach not only promotes decarbonization but also boosts regional economic growth. The market is also witnessing a trend towards renewable hydrogen as costs decrease, and policies advocate for decarbonization. This shift is supported by the increasing capacity of green production technologies and the commitments of various countries to achieve net-zero emissions by 2050. The transition to renewable sources is complemented by investments in storage and distribution networks, fostering a sustainable hydrogen market. Overall, the global hydrogen market is poised for sustainable growth driven by industry dynamics, technological advancements, and the global shift towards clean energy and decarbonization.
